It’s a Matter of Trust: Ngāi Tahu Democratic Processes and Māori Pākehā Research Partnership

Abstract: The Ngāi Tahu indigenous Māori community of Aotearoa/New Zealand successfully maintained 150 years of legal grievance against the British Crown following the signing of the Treaty of Waitangi and colonization.
